我尝试在已经有一个节点的集群中添加一个新节点,得到与landim相同的错误
$ ccm status
Cluster: 'cluster2'
n1: UP
$ ccm add n2 -i 127.0.1.2 -j 7200
$ ccm status
Cluster: 'cluster2'
n1: UP
n2: DOWN (Not initialized)
$ ccm n2 start
开始:n2 with pid:3004 Traceback(最近一次呼叫最后一次):
文件“E:\ Studies \ Cassandra \ ccm \ ccm-master \ ccm.py”,第74行, cmd.run()文件 “E:\ Studies \ Cassandra \ ccm \ ccm-master \ ccmlib \ cmds \ node_cmds.py”,line 206,在运行allow_root = self.options.allow_root)文件 “E:\ Studies \ Cassandra \ ccm \ ccm-master \ ccmlib \ node.py”,第597行, start node.watch_log_for_alive(self,from_mark = mark)文件 “E:\ Studies \ Cassandra \ ccm \ ccm-master \ ccmlib \ node.py”,第449行, watch_log_for_alive self.watch_log_for(tofind, from_mark = from_mark,timeout = timeout,filename = filename)文件 “E:\ Studies \ Cassandra \ ccm \ ccm-master \ ccmlib \ node.py”,第417行, watch_log_for引发TimeoutError(time.strftime(“%d%b%Y %H:%M:%S“,time.gmtime())+”[“+ self.name +”]缺少:“+ str([eTtern for e in tofind])+“:\ n”+读取[:50] +“..... \ n查看{} 对于余数“.format(filename))ccmlib.node.TimeoutError:2016年3月20日05:22:05 [n1]缺失:['127.0.1.2。*现在UP']:.....请参阅system.log以了解其余内容
我在node2(n2)logs目录中看不到任何system.log文件。我不确定上述错误记录的方式和位置!!!
注意: ccm populate -n完美无缺。 ccm add会引发错误。
Windows 10上的CCM。C *版本:3.0.3